Output 7631f5a83388db1c4356cf300201ce4b81e492c563e9ecf047c58ac6a27fb19a:1

value
623490
script pubkey
OP_0 OP_PUSHBYTES_20 827e37c32c0c5a656be9051a995757a1e1f458bd
address
ltc1qsflr0sevp3dx26lfq5dfj46h58slgk9acq363a
transaction
7631f5a83388db1c4356cf300201ce4b81e492c563e9ecf047c58ac6a27fb19a
spent
true